Commit Graph

  • 12d924904d kasjdaksjd jyelon 2026-04-07 05:06:45 -04:00
  • b8cff00848 More work on material instances jyelon 2026-04-07 05:06:15 -04:00
  • e7fd6c2f70 Trying to get material parameters into a polished state. jyelon 2026-04-06 18:55:17 -04:00
  • 8951065670 Give FindOneWithInternalID the power to handle arrays of smart pointers. Eliminate FindNoneWithInternalID, finish migration to FindNoDuplicateNames. jyelon 2026-04-06 04:37:28 -04:00
  • 7aac8f194a Precompute broad type categories in WingTypes. jyelon 2026-04-06 02:56:21 -04:00
  • 5206700067 Harden UE Wingman request handling and numeric property conversion. jyelon 2026-04-06 01:44:21 -04:00
  • 9c1f474170 work on material parameters jyelon 2026-04-05 03:20:51 -04:00
  • c949a4db05 Better handling of property mutability, and also, walk into structs. jyelon 2026-04-04 23:57:59 -04:00
  • bd138e2790 Fix bug in package loading jyelon 2026-04-04 21:07:13 -04:00
  • fb5b774bfe better expression of class properties jyelon 2026-04-04 20:10:22 -04:00
  • 47acf1aca4 Simplification of handlers jyelon 2026-04-04 18:12:10 -04:00
  • c006531bd4 Create_OneArg now working jyelon 2026-04-04 17:59:00 -04:00
  • 92e41c857a Lots of refactoring jyelon 2026-04-04 05:22:08 -04:00
  • ba63a40641 More refactoring jyelon 2026-04-04 02:58:23 -04:00
  • 7c884e84cb Back in business jyelon 2026-04-04 02:21:04 -04:00
  • e9fff6599a Enormouse overhaul jyelon 2026-04-04 01:45:25 -04:00
  • b1a2813f05 Migrating back to WingProperty. Sigh. jyelon 2026-04-03 19:54:50 -04:00
  • 297586f351 Nice try on WingPropHandle jyelon 2026-04-03 19:07:39 -04:00
  • daa9216ddf Migrating toward WingPropHandle jyelon 2026-04-03 17:05:48 -04:00
  • a0c5a56476 More work on properties jyelon 2026-04-03 15:52:07 -04:00
  • c19091ef1f More work on property jyelon 2026-04-03 15:03:59 -04:00
  • e70bce0ede Prop Get2/Set2 jyelon 2026-04-03 11:42:40 -04:00
  • fe4a4d5646 Prop Get2/Set2 jyelon 2026-04-03 11:41:21 -04:00
  • 78a3ca3e72 More work on properties jyelon 2026-04-03 11:29:58 -04:00
  • 4f09d6caf0 More work on props jyelon 2026-04-03 00:20:41 -04:00
  • 5fc9ce63ad Property manipulation now getting closer jyelon 2026-04-02 04:39:05 -04:00
  • 2e2bb89de0 New infrastructure for property manipulation. jyelon 2026-04-02 02:27:14 -04:00
  • 7865818e69 Another registration overhaul jyelon 2026-04-01 18:12:54 -04:00
  • 483b3b75ff Handler registration overhaul jyelon 2026-04-01 17:45:33 -04:00
  • 7e53975e3d Minor bugfix jyelon 2026-04-01 05:47:24 -04:00
  • efb1c94144 Working on Asset_Create jyelon 2026-04-01 05:10:00 -04:00
  • 89815bcd13 Config files for claude and codex jyelon 2026-03-31 17:38:52 -04:00
  • 94ca40d3d6 Some work on manual jyelon 2026-03-31 17:34:17 -04:00
  • d590d71421 WingVariables for the win jyelon 2026-03-31 16:43:28 -04:00
  • 43f2439f29 More work on variables jyelon 2026-03-31 04:54:44 -04:00
  • 93ce030fc0 More progress on variables jyelon 2026-03-31 03:50:06 -04:00
  • 9720fa9f8d Progress on variable modification jyelon 2026-03-30 23:45:53 -04:00
  • e982fec1a4 Code is all tore up jyelon 2026-03-30 20:10:23 -04:00
  • 386455b1d0 WingTypes now uses the new tokenizer. jyelon 2026-03-30 05:34:17 -04:00
  • a2221bca94 About to overhaul WingTypes jyelon 2026-03-30 05:01:20 -04:00
  • 339495ae3b More work on tokenizer jyelon 2026-03-30 00:57:28 -04:00
  • 6041641c74 More cleanup of Internal/External IDs jyelon 2026-03-29 15:11:45 -04:00
  • 091bfe1ad2 Lots more progress on the name overhaul jyelon 2026-03-29 02:37:47 -04:00
  • 843e16b177 Starting to convert old search functions to new ones jyelon 2026-03-29 01:14:58 -04:00
  • 2ad86bac1d Implemented new functions FindOneWithExternalID, etc. jyelon 2026-03-28 23:47:05 -04:00
  • 9790fa34e1 Name sanitization overhaul in progress jyelon 2026-03-28 21:07:28 -04:00
  • 22fe60f431 Converted over to new name sanitization routine jyelon 2026-03-28 20:04:48 -04:00
  • 88fa260c9d Tokenizer is now done, we also have the new InternalizeID and ExternalizeID jyelon 2026-03-28 19:29:15 -04:00
  • 5aef356199 More work on the new variable list functionality jyelon 2026-03-27 19:27:49 -04:00
  • 656151ca3b This handler is unneeded jyelon 2026-03-27 15:52:48 -04:00
  • df50daca2c More work on Actor components jyelon 2026-03-27 15:21:38 -04:00
  • 490b649dc1 Don't know jyelon 2026-03-27 13:40:22 -04:00
  • a5ab6b02f9 Massive overhaul of the WingActorComponent system, can now edit component properties better, lots of bug fixes jyelon 2026-03-27 05:16:49 -04:00
  • 3bbddde491 Working on component property editing jyelon 2026-03-26 19:54:32 -04:00
  • 1ee2067505 Better handling of JSON property setters jyelon 2026-03-26 19:16:59 -04:00
  • 0f7bfebb71 More work on automatic self-documentation jyelon 2026-03-26 17:07:58 -04:00
  • 2bb8baac4c Framework for printing abridged manual sections in response to syntactic mistakes jyelon 2026-03-26 16:17:06 -04:00
  • 93b396578f A few more error reporting improvements jyelon 2026-03-25 17:39:33 -04:00
  • 654511c6cf A few more error reporting improvements jyelon 2026-03-25 17:36:04 -04:00
  • c02ae3fb97 Graph_Dump no longer elides Knot and VariableGet nodes. jyelon 2026-03-25 17:24:02 -04:00
  • bcb79ad0ab Better error reporting in WingFetcher jyelon 2026-03-25 17:13:00 -04:00
  • 89231987f2 Improvements to ranking in TypeName_Search jyelon 2026-03-25 15:39:37 -04:00
  • 6325b15cb7 Lots of work on WingTypes jyelon 2026-03-25 02:32:26 -04:00
  • 03e61cd9a0 UE Wingman getting ready for release jyelon 2026-03-23 19:41:27 -04:00
  • 4c84b1a5b7 UE Wingman getting ready for release jyelon 2026-03-23 19:34:42 -04:00
  • 928abb5916 Remove the deprecated crap from UE Wingman jyelon 2026-03-23 17:48:00 -04:00
  • 2bc06f3b02 Widget reparenting done. jyelon 2026-03-23 17:29:48 -04:00
  • 5657d76ed6 Widget_Create is implemented jyelon 2026-03-23 16:21:51 -04:00
  • 741253fd3b Remove undo/redo code from UE Wingman jyelon 2026-03-23 14:33:50 -04:00
  • 92b03d376d Widget slot properties are now shown jyelon 2026-03-23 14:10:26 -04:00
  • 2a064f3666 Working on better handling of property setters jyelon 2026-03-23 00:18:12 -04:00
  • f38630ea08 Code to make Blueprint_Reparent safer. jyelon 2026-03-22 15:44:32 -04:00
  • f94727d857 BlueprintGraph_Delete jyelon 2026-03-21 00:43:54 -04:00
  • e493155035 BlueprintGraph_Create jyelon 2026-03-21 00:34:51 -04:00
  • 8fbfd588f5 GraphNode_Rename is good jyelon 2026-03-20 23:03:41 -04:00
  • af141a2369 Working on handling custom event nodes jyelon 2026-03-20 22:53:09 -04:00
  • 457c595081 Event dispatcher support complete jyelon 2026-03-20 20:02:53 -04:00
  • 90b35f785e More refactoring in MCP jyelon 2026-03-20 19:40:29 -04:00
  • ca6b3f9768 Halfway done with Dispatcher stuff jyelon 2026-03-20 16:18:03 -04:00
  • 0ac9a01859 Fix a lot of broken menu stuff in MCP jyelon 2026-03-20 14:56:40 -04:00
  • acc5bafe34 Halfway through with repair of right-click menus jyelon 2026-03-20 03:16:50 -04:00
  • 77a3c552f8 Fix name lookup in WingActorComponent jyelon 2026-03-19 22:52:39 -04:00
  • fae73e821d Blueprints switch from data-only to full when modified in that way. jyelon 2026-03-19 22:15:04 -04:00
  • 9ad6515fb5 More work on blueprint component lists jyelon 2026-03-19 20:44:04 -04:00
  • 2eb2be7af1 More work on properties of components jyelon 2026-03-19 16:26:00 -04:00
  • 56f2257dd9 Work on blueprint components in MCP jyelon 2026-03-19 15:53:25 -04:00
  • 2e4606c9e4 Added WingActorComponent jyelon 2026-03-19 13:32:05 -04:00
  • 3688a36682 More blueprint handler work jyelon 2026-03-19 12:37:36 -04:00
  • 9812a4a413 More refinement of Wing server jyelon 2026-03-19 12:01:38 -04:00
  • a9258f3a86 Enum handling is now centralized jyelon 2026-03-19 11:19:31 -04:00
  • 23c096b614 Removed all code to save packages from the MCP jyelon 2026-03-19 10:56:20 -04:00
  • d6cc090aca Change syntax back to normal jyelon 2026-03-19 10:16:44 -04:00
  • cc3d03541c WingUtils::FormatName uses WingTypes::TypeToTextOrDie for types jyelon 2026-03-19 01:52:14 -04:00
  • e9ad41bbb3 Replace delimiters with unicode shapes jyelon 2026-03-19 00:40:27 -04:00
  • 467c1464aa Much better handling of type lookups jyelon 2026-03-18 23:20:10 -04:00
  • 336b80df39 Improve the WingTypes registry jyelon 2026-03-18 23:10:09 -04:00
  • a18cff3fc9 Routines to find exactly one jyelon 2026-03-18 21:48:56 -04:00
  • ce7b8bc39a Tidy up WingUtils::FormatName jyelon 2026-03-18 20:31:54 -04:00
  • 809de505b6 Notification changes in UE Wingman jyelon 2026-03-18 20:08:50 -04:00
  • 230f104fda More work on Blueprint_Dump jyelon 2026-03-18 18:39:13 -04:00